This 125 hectares (125 000m2) portion of land is found in the very secure Swartberg Private Wildlife Estate in the Green Karoo, on the slopes of the majestic Swartberg Mountain. The Swartberg Mountains forms part of the Cape Floral Region,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, and are known for their diverse ecosystems, geological formations and the magnificent Swartberg Pass, a scenic route connecting Prince Albert and Oudtshoorn.

The estate, which consists of 16 of these 125 hectares portions, is managed by a very well organized landowners association.
The association is responsible for, among many other things, maintaining the extensive network of gravel roads on the estate, removing all invasive alien vegetation which can become a huge threat to the ecosystem, manage the population sizes of the various species of animals of the estate and maintaining the parameter fence of the estate. There are no fences between the portions. This allows for the animals to roam freely around the estate from one portion to the next.
